Statutory Frameworks & Compliance for Debtor Information Retrieval in Kenya
Retrieving debtor information Kisumu requires strict adherence to Kenya's legal and regulatory landscape to ensure compliance and avoid legal repercussions. Key statutory frameworks governing this process include the Data Protection Act, 2019, which safeguards personal data, and the Civil Procedure Act, Cap 21, which outlines the judicial processes for debt recovery. Swipe Recoveries Experts Ltd operates within these stringent guidelines, ensuring that all information gathered is obtained legally and ethically. We understand the nuances of compliance, including requirements set forth by the Central Bank of Kenya (CBK) for financial institutions and the professional ethics expected from debt recovery agents. Our methods, which may include reviewing publicly available records, corporate filings under the Companies Act, 2015, or licensed Credit Reference Bureau (CRB) data, are meticulously vetted. Our team works closely with legal counsel when necessary, particularly when obtaining court orders for sensitive information or preparing affidavits for litigation. By adhering to these frameworks, we not only protect our clients from potential legal challenges but also enhance the credibility and admissibility of the retrieved information in any subsequent judicial proceedings at institutions like the Kisumu Law Courts.

Cost & Fee Expectations for Debtor Information Services in Kisumu

Understanding the cost associated with obtaining debtor information Kisumu is crucial for effective budget planning. Swipe Recoveries Experts Ltd offers transparent and competitive fee structures tailored to the complexity and scope of each investigation. Our services are typically charged on a project basis, reflecting the resources deployed, the estimated duration of the search, and the difficulty in locating the specific information or individual. For basic skip tracing services, clients can expect fees to range from approximately KES 15,000 to KES 50,000, depending on the depth of the search. More intricate asset tracing or comprehensive debtor profiling, which might involve extensive field work or legal support, could range from KES 50,000 to KES 150,000 or more. We provide a detailed quotation upfront, ensuring no hidden costs. While some cases may involve success-based fees for debt recovery services, our information retrieval services are generally fixed-fee or retainer-based.
